What we do
RevealHim is a reverse lookup service. You type a phone number, an email address, a photo or a license plate, and we pull together what's publicly known about it across more than a dozen verified data sources. The output is a single readable report — owner, carrier, location, social profiles, possible addresses, spam reputation. Not magic, just careful aggregation of data that's already out in the open.
We are not a background-check provider. We are not regulated by the FCRA in the United States. Our reports are for personal informational use only — figuring out who that 415 number belonged to, checking whether a Craigslist seller actually exists, verifying that the person who keeps texting your partner is who you think they are. We're deliberately built for those everyday situations, not for employment, lending, insurance or tenancy decisions.

Where our data comes from
We do not own a private database of phone subscribers. Instead, we query and combine data from established providers, each licensed for the purpose we use it for:
- Telecom carrier registries for line type, country, current operator
- Public phone directories for residential landline data
- Caller ID aggregators (Truecaller-class providers) for name suggestions and photos
- Public records databases for historical addresses, family connections (US-strong)
- Social network public profiles for cross-referencing identity
- Data breach archives (HaveIBeenPwned and similar) for security-related signals
- Image search engines (Google Vision) for our photo lookup module
When data conflicts between sources, we display the most-corroborated version and flag the rest. Where data isn't available, we say so rather than making something up.
